August 17, 1912
Thinking of oneself and thinking of Jesus
Volume 11

Jesus- As I was praying, my blessed Jesus told me: “My daughter, the thought of oneself makes the soul
smaller, and from her littleness she measures my greatness, almost wanting to constrain Me. On the other hand,
one who does not think of herself but thinks of Me becomes greater within my immensity and renders Me the
honor due to Me.”

Scripture Meditation- For by the grace given to me I bid every one among you not to think of himself more highly than he ought to think, but to think with sober judgment, each according to the measure of faith which God has assigned him. (Romans 12:3)
